I have a couple of family trees downloaded from GenesReunited. I need to change them to correct some systematic errors and missing relationships (e.g. cousin marriages).

I am trying out GenoPro for this purpose and it seems clear that it will do what I need - but only when I can find out how to do everything. It is not easy to continually look up different pages on the web. Or to get help tips flashing up on the screen but disappearing as soon as I try to perform some action.

How can I get hold of a complete users' guide?

I suggest your read the "Getting Started" page at: http://www.genopro.com/introduction/

If you need help on a specific subjet you can click on any links in the left menu.

There is also tutorial videos available online: http://www.genopro.com/tutorials/videos/

There is also an offline version of the help files available from http://www.genopro.com/faq/how-do-i-download-help-files-for-offline-use.aspx. You could then set up your screen so that you can view GenoPro and the help files side-by-side so that you can easily switch between the two.
